Lunana Wild Snowman Trek 24days

Bhutan Packed Trekking HorsesThis trek is recognized by enthusiasts as the toughest trek in the world because of its altitude, distance, climate and remoteness. At the same time, the Lunana region of Bhutan is one of the most beautiful areas of the world and the least visited. Though many do not finish the entire trek, we have developed a plan that will help anyone complete the entire distance in 18 days. We have included acclimatization (first 3 days in Bhutan), rest days, and cultural experiences that will refresh and encourage you along the way. You do not have to be brave, you just have to have to be determined. Your experienced guide will help you set the needed pace for each day of the trek. Careful planning for each trek to the Lunana region includes our expert local guide, pack horses, cold weather equipment, and a cook. From the time you arrive you will be cared for and know exactly what to expect. Your guides are also prepared for any emergency that could happen.

  • Day1: Flight to Paro:
    Visit Ta Dzong, Rinpung Dzong and Kyichu Lhakhang.
  • Day2: Paro – Thimphu: Hike to Taktsang monastery and evening drive to Thimphu. (Mainly to acclimatize)
  • Day3: Thimphu – Punakha: Sightseeing in Thimphu - After noon drive to Punakha and Punakha Dzong sightseeing and go to camp.
  • Day4: Punakha-Tashithang-Geon Damji. Start the Snowman trek. Overnight camp.
  • Day5: Geon Damji - Gasa,
  • Day6: Gasa - Koena
  • Day7: Koena - Laya
  • Day8: Laya halt to rest and explore Laya village.
  • Day9: Laya - Rodophu
  • Day10: Rodophu - Narithang
  • Day11: Narithang - Tarina
  • Day12: Tarina - Woche
  • Day13: Woche - Lhedi
  • Day14: Lhedi - Thanza
  • Day15: Thanza halt. for rest.
  • Day16: Thanza - Tshochena
  • Day17: Tshochena - Jichu Dramo
  • Day18: Jichu Dramo - Chukarpo
  • Day19: Chukarpo - Tampetsho
  • Day20: Tampetsho - Maorothang
  • Day21: Maorothang - Nikachu (end of trek).
  • Day22: Nikachu drive to Thimphu.
  • Day23: Sightseeing in Thimphu. Evening drive to Paro
  • Day24: Fly to Bangkok/Del/Ktm
